Address

KM7EED5M3bBbxpJCtdXvkM6uSVYCyJUK3W

0 KUMA

Confirmed
Total Received422.30572000 KUMA
Total Sent422.30572000 KUMA
Final Balance0 KUMA
No. Transactions2

Transactions

KM7EED5M3bBbxpJCtdXvkM6uSVYCyJUK3W422.30572000 KUMA
 
 
KM7EED5M3bBbxpJCtdXvkM6uSVYCyJUK3W422.30572000 KUMA